April 27, 1982 Before Sluggo's arrived on the scene in 1981, authentic Vienna beef hot dogs were not on the menu in San Diego. The first restaurant was on Mission Boulevard in Pacific Beach--and shortly after, a second location opened in La Jolla on La Jolla Blvd. The Chicago style hot dogs were amazing. Burgers and Italian beef were popular too.
Owner William Rohde's son Greg reached out to CBS 8 to see if we have Sluggo's stories in our archive. Indeed we do, and were happy to resurrect.
